About BNP Paribas India Solutions

Established in 2005, BNP Paribas India Solutions is a wholly owned subsidiary of BNP Paribas SA, European Union’s leading bank with an international reach. With delivery centers located in Bengaluru, Chennai and Mumbai, we are a 24x7 global delivery center. India Solutions services three business lines: Corporate and Institutional Banking, Investment Solutions and Retail Banking for BNP Paribas across the Group. Driving innovation and growth, we are harnessing the potential of over 10000 employees, to provide support and develop best-in-class solutions.

Technical Skills


Required: Skill Group - Core Java & JDK 21+    

1. Modern language features – records, sealed classes, pattern matching, text blocks, and functional APIs (streams, Optional).

2. Concurrency & Parallelism – virtual threads (Project Loom), Completable Future, Executor Service, Fork/Join, and basic lock/atomic primitives.

3. JVM & GC tuning – G1/ZGC behaviour, heap dump analysis, JFR profiling, and module system (JPMS) usage.

4. Logging / Instrumentation / Error Handling

5. Build & Unit test foundation – Maven/Gradle multi module builds, JUnit 5 + AssertJ, static code checks (SpotBugs), and basic GraalVM native image awareness.

Spring Ecosystem    

1. Spring Boot 3.x – create micro service skeletons, auto configuration, actuator health checks, and simple security (JWT/OAuth2)., 

2. Spring Data (JPA/R2DBC) – entity mapping, query hint optimisation, reactive repositories, and transaction demarcation.

3. Spring Cloud basics – service discovery (Eureka), API gateway pattern, externalised config (Config Server), and circuit breaker (Resilience4j).

4. Either Spring Batch OR Spring MVC OR Spring Integration

5. Spring Security fundamentals – CSRF protection, OAuth2 resource server setup, basic role based access control, and token validation.

Database & Data Access Engineering  

 1. SQL & query optimisation – complex CTEs, window functions, indexing strategies, and execution plan analysis (PostgreSQL/Oracle/MySQL).

2. ORM performance – JPA/Hibernate mapping, N+1 detection, second level cache, batch inserts/updates, and @QueryHints.

3. NoSQL & caching – when to use MongoDB, GraphDB, Redis (session/Cache aside), basic data modeling, and TTL/eviction policies.

4. Migrations & transactions – Flyway/Liquibase versioning, multi DB transaction handling (JTA), and isolation level choices.

Design & Architecture  

1. Clean / Hexagonal architecture – ports and adapters, dependency inversion, and keeping frameworks at the outer ring.

2. Domain Driven Design basics – bounded contexts, aggregates, domain events, and idempotent processing.

3. API first & contract – OpenAPI/Swagger spec authoring, versioning strategy, and consumer driven contract testing (Pact).

4. Event driven patterns – Kafka or RabbitMQ producers/consumers, out box pattern, and basic saga (choreography) implementation.

5. Security: Public Keys / Hash Concepts. Design around Access Control, Role Based security.

6. Awareness around: Microservices design Pattern 

Concepts like - Circuit breaker, load balancer

DevOps      

1. Containerisation & K8s – Docker multi stage builds, Helm chart basics, pod liveness/readiness probes.

2. CI/CD pipeline basics – Jenkins/Argo CD job that runs unit, integration, and static analysis steps; artefact publishing.

3. Observability starter – expose Prometheus metrics, configure a basic Grafana dashboard, and ship structured logs to ELK.

Testing & Quality Engineering    1. Test pyramid implementation – unit (JUnit 5/Mockito), integration (Testcontainers), contract (Pact).

2. Performance & load testing – JMeter script creation, baseline latency/SLO definition, simple analysis of results.

3. Static analysis & coverage – SonarQube quality gate, JaCoCo coverage threshold, SpotBugs rule set.
